What Features Should a Best Bike Speedometer GP Include?

The best bike speedometer GP should include several essential features for optimal performance and user experience.

  • GPS Tracking: This feature allows the speedometer to accurately measure your speed and distance traveled using satellite signals. It is essential for tracking your route and analyzing your performance during rides.
  • Speed and Distance Metrics: A reliable speedometer should display real-time speed and cumulative distance traveled. These metrics help cyclists monitor their performance and set personal records during rides.
  • Heart Rate Monitoring: Many advanced speedometers come with heart rate sensors that provide valuable data on your cardiovascular performance. This feature helps cyclists gauge their effort levels and stay within targeted heart rate zones for better training results.
  • Cadence Measurement: This feature measures how quickly you are pedaling, typically displayed in revolutions per minute (RPM). Monitoring cadence can help cyclists optimize their pedaling efficiency and improve overall riding performance.
  • Weather Resistance: A durable, weather-resistant design is crucial for outdoor cycling. This feature ensures that the speedometer can withstand rain, dirt, and varying temperatures, making it suitable for all riding conditions.
  • Long Battery Life: A speedometer with extended battery life is essential for long rides. This feature minimizes the need for frequent recharges, allowing cyclists to focus on their journey without worrying about battery depletion.
  • Smartphone Connectivity: Many modern speedometers offer Bluetooth or Wi-Fi connectivity to sync with mobile apps. This feature enables cyclists to analyze their ride data, share achievements on social media, and receive real-time notifications.
  • Customizable Display: A speedometer with a customizable display allows users to choose which metrics they want to see during their ride. This flexibility helps cyclists prioritize the data that matters most to them, enhancing their riding experience.
  • Navigation Features: Integrated navigation capabilities help cyclists follow predefined routes or discover new trails. This feature can be particularly useful for long-distance rides or when exploring unfamiliar areas.
  • Multiple Sport Modes: Some speedometers cater to various activities, including cycling, running, and hiking. This versatility allows users to track performance across different sports, making the device a multi-functional training tool.

What Factors Contribute to the Accuracy of a Bike Speedometer GP?

The accuracy of a bike speedometer GPS is influenced by several key factors:

  • Satellite Signal Strength: GPS devices rely on signals from multiple satellites. The more satellites the device can connect to, the more accurate the readings will be. Obstructions like tall buildings or dense foliage can weaken signals.

  • Device Calibration: A speedometer must be calibrated correctly for accurate data. It involves setting the wheel size and ensuring proper installation, as errors in calibration can lead to inaccurate speed readings.

  • Environmental Factors: Weather conditions such as heavy rain, fog, or snow can affect signal accuracy. Additionally, changes in terrain—like hilly or uneven surfaces—can impact how speed is calculated.

  • Software Updates: Manufacturers often release updates to enhance accuracy and performance. Using the latest software ensures that the speedometer benefits from any improvements and fixes.

  • User Settings: Incorrect settings regarding unit preference (miles vs. kilometers) or personal data (weight, age) may lead to misleading readings. Properly inputting personal information can help improve accuracy in calculations.

By taking these factors into account, cyclists can ensure they get reliable speed data from their bike speedometers.
